We offer five proprietary systems that act as a truss roof:
AlumadomeTM
This single layer aluminum system is offered as either an integral structural
glazing system or support framing for a roof and insulation system. Because they
are capable of spanning more than 500 feet, AlumadomeTM systems are
used for double curvature overhead applications. A unique feature is that this
system may be custom designed to develop a broad range of shapes. Typical
building footprint applications include ellipsoidal, oval, rectangular and
circular.
OmnihubTM
This lightweight, all-aluminum structural system offers unlimited design
flexibility and strength. The geometric forms, structural footprint and
structure profile are literally unlimited. With its concealed fastening system,
tapered end connectors, round members and solid aluminum hubs, the system offers
an unrivaled appearance, smooth lines and boundless finishing possibilities.
StadiaformTM
Our patent pending StadiaformTM double layer space frame system
offers architects and designers unparalleled design strength and a broad
selection of low profile building envelopes. Combining the design benefits of
aluminum with the strength of double layer configurations, StadiaformTM spans more
than 600 feet and conforms to any building footprint.
GeohubTM
This fully integrated aluminum structural system allows direct attachment of any
independent glazing system directly to the top of the space frame struts. It is
a modular system that is ideally suited for monosloped glazing applications.
Because it is flexible in module size, shape and depth, the GeohubTM
allows the creation of networks with unlimited footprints while accommodating
diverse designs.
